What is a home inspection?
A home inspection is a non invasive evaluation of a home and the various systems that are found in a home. Examples of systems are plumbing, electrical, or heating. The home inspector is an impartial party in the home buying process. Their main duty is to look for anything that presents a safety concern. Their other concerns are any issues with the home that could present costly repair bills to a home buyer.
Can I come along on home inspections?
Clients are welcome to accompany me on inspections. This way they can see what I am seeing in real time. 
How does the inspector convey their findings?
A report is generated and sent via email to the client. The report will include images of any issues with the home. The report is written with the intent to be easily understandable to clients regardlesss of their level of knowledge of homes and home systems.
